What Youll Do:

  • Provide and document skilled nursing care based on individualized care plans and physician orders
  • Perform patient assessments and create personalized care strategies that support recovery and independence
  • Educate patients and families on specific medications, symptom management and lifestyle changes to promote better patient outcomes and independence in the home
  • Train and support caregivers to ensure safe and effective care at home
  • Deliver a broad range of hands-on care, including wound care, infusions, catheter care, pain management, medication management, vital signs, post-operative care, etc.
  • Collaborate closely with physicians and care teams to ensure coordinated, high-quality outcomes
